JOB DESCRIPTION

 

Title:

 

Building Principal

Qualifications:

 

Holds New Jersey certification as principal, supervisor or director of student personnel services

Primary Function:

 

Serves as the administrative head of a school building and assumes responsibility for the effective administration and supervision of all activities within that unit.

Report Level:

Superintendent of Schools

 

Major Duties and Responsibilities:

 

1.      General Administrative/Supervisory Duties

 

A.     Supervises the implementation of all student related non-instructional programs.

 

B.     Supervises all personnel utilized in the implementation of school programs.

 

C.     Prepares and submits accurate, complete and timely reports as required by the central office.

 

D.     Develops and maintains procedures for insuring the efficient and orderly operation of the school.

 

E.      Participates in the ongoing events of both the administrative team and curriculum team.

 

F.      Delegates, where appropriate, responsibilities to other administrators and support staff.

 

2.      Recruitment, Recommendation and Assignment of Personnel

 

A.     Participates with central office staff in the selection of new personnel.

 

B.     Participates with central office staff and peers in the assignment of in-district personnel.

 

3.      Establishment and Maintenance of Learning Climate

 

A.     Promotes good motivational techniques.

 

B.     Recognizes the achievements of students and faculty.

 

C.     Maintains acceptable standards of student conduct and enforces discipline as necessary, according to due process to the rights of students.

 

D.     Develops and maintains procedures for insuring good attendance of students and staff.

 

E.      Develops programs to maintain morale of staff and students.

 

F.      Maintains effective communications with staff and students.

 

4.      Evaluation of Professional Staff

 

A.     Evaluates, according to board policy and administrative procedures, all certified personnel assigned by the central office.

 

B.     Makes annual recommendations to the superintendent of schools concerning employment status.

 

5.      Curriculum Development and Improvement

 

A.     Participates in curriculum development.

 

B.     Participates in the development of inservice programs.

 

C.     Provides leadership in curriculum development and implementation.

 

6.      Effective Use and Maintenance of the School Plant

 

A.     Assures the operational efficiency of the building equipment and operations (heating, lighting, ventilation).

 

B.     Assures that building and grounds are safe, clean and sanitary.

 

7.      Preparation and Administration of School Budget

 

A.     Plans and develops annual building budget requests with involvement of school personnel to reflect school needs.

 

B.     Utilizes established policies and procedures in purchasing and obtaining needed goods and services.

 

C.     Stays within approved budget allocations.

 

D.     Submits capital improvement program needs as requested by superintendent of schools.

 

8.      Establishment and Maintenance of a Public Relations Program

 

A.     Provides effective communications with parents and the community at large.

 

B.     Encourages and provides activities for community involvement.

 

C.     Conducts appropriate group meetings to interpret school programs to the community.

 

9.      Professional Growth Activities

 

A.     Attends and participates in professional meetings.

 

B.     Stays abreast of developments within the profession by reading professional literature.

 

C.     Encourages staff participation in professional growth activities.

 

10.  Legal Aspects of School Operation

 

A.     Knows, understands and implements state laws, rules and regulations, policies of the board of education, negotiated agreements and approved administrative procedures.
